Cody walk-in clinic sets hours for respiratory patients

Drive-thru COVID testing continues

Posted

Cody Regional Health’s Walk-In Clinic is requiring all respiratory related patients to be seen between 11 a.m. and 3 p.m., Monday through Friday.

Located at 424 Yellowstone Ave. in Cody, the clinic will have double provider coverage to make sure every patient with non-severe symptoms of respiratory illness, influenza-like illness or the stomach flu (nausea, vomiting, diarrhea) are seen during these hours to “help facilitate the best and most timely care possible.” Patients experiencing COVID-19 symptoms including shortness of breath, chest pain, palpitations or other more serious symptoms should go to the closest ER or call 911.

Cody Regional Health is also offering drive-thru COVID-19 testing on Tuesdays and Thursdays, starting at 8 a.m. and offered on a first-come, first-served basis until the allotted tests are gone.

“Depending on what type of test supplies are available (and supply availability can change daily), your test results may take up to seven days to receive,” Cody Regional Health officials said last month. “Please know we are doing everything possible to secure testing supplies and provide our communities with as many tests as we can.”
